KUALA LUMPUR: The FBM KLCI extended its losses at midday on Monday weighed by PetGas and BAT, as investors stayed on the sidelines due to the slump in China's recent economic data.
At 12.30pm the KLCI fell 8.73 points to 1,846.91. Turnover was 1.04 billion shares valued at RM694.21mil. There were 168 gainers, 555 decliners and 269 counters unchanged.
